Trattoria El Greco on 30th is Almost There

Since the summertime, I've been closely watching the progress of a new Trattoria on 30th Avenue.  Its name is rumored to be El Greco Trattoria, owned by a Greek proprietor who aspires to put his own spin on Italian food.  For a long time, the facade has been blocked off by plywood, but not anymore.  The nice wooden and stone exterior is an inviting preview for things to come (eh hem...brick oven pizza)!  Its expected time of opening is at the end of this month, so stay tuned for further details and the menu.

Trattoria El Greco - Corner of 30th Avenue and 37th Street, Astoria NY 11103
N/W Train to 30th Avenue
